I replaced the passenger side rear tail light assembly of my Toyota Camry 2007. The method is same for the late models till 2011 no matter what the side is.
Its very easy to unscrew 3 nuts inside the trunk after removing the only portion of cover that covers the light but this is not it, there is a bracket under the light assembly which actually holds the edge of bumper and in order to pull it out of the bumper, bumper has to be partially taken out or loosen out.
To began the process I took the wheel out to unscrew 2 screws located right behind the wheel on the lining of bumper cover holding the mud flapper at the same time, if you have small philips screw driver of approx 2" length you might not need to remove the entire wheel. please see the image 1 as I took the pictures while fixing the light up and that too all alone.
There are 2 more screws to be taken out one holds the flap and other
holds the bumper cover, all need to be taken out to bring the flap apart.
Now there is a most
critical and important part for the entire job, after loosing the screws
and after pulling the flap down there is a hidden bolt which will come with small sized socket (usually available in basic socket set kit)
Loose the bolt like this.
Now just hold the loose side of the bumper cover and pull it out towards yourself, that particular cover side will easily come off.
You need to loose another screw hiding in the cover right behind the bumper, open the cover with a help of the plain flat screw driver and take the bolt out.
You have just loosen the edge of bumper cover holding the bracket of light, just pull the light towards you while facing it (do not forget to unplug the power supply sockets as in next image) bend it little to the top and slide the bracket out of the bumper cover edge and you got the light assembly out in your hand.
Disconnect or unplug the power supply from the sockets, just
press the plastic tip and pull the plug out from the light socket, if
you just forget the order don't worry, the gray will go in gray and
black one in black (please do this in the very first stage as i forgot
to put this in a beginning)
Now hold the new assembly, slide it's bracket in the bumper cover edge (the way it was taken off) slide the light carefully as there is a round shape plastic part in the body needs to hold the corner edge of the light assembly
Put the 3 nuts back on the light bolts from inside the trunk.
Attach the power sockets.
Push the snapped out side edge of the bumper cover back to its framing, the click sounds will confirm its proper attachment now put all the screws back in a same way they were taken out but don't forget to putting back the mud flap.
At the final stage, just mount back moldings from inside the trunk, please refer to the images, there are 2 bolts and rest clip in typed sockets, sometimes while snapping the moldings out the white male female clips remain in their housings, just take them out with hand or screw driver and put them back carefully back to the plastic molding before tucking them back
